Key Points for Relieving Constipation -Start by reviewing your lifestyle habits- (1) Establish regular bowel habits: Aim to use the toilet once daily at a set time (ideally after breakfast). It is important not to ignore the urge to go.(2) Improve your diet. Maintain three regular meals daily. Consume foods rich in dietary fiber (vegetables, beans, root vegetables, seaweed, etc.) every day. Drinking plenty of fluids is also important. (3) Get moderate exercise. Lack of exercise is a major cause of constipation. Engage in moderate exercise to strengthen your abdominal muscles. Massaging your stomach is also beneficial.Corac Dosage Advice
(1) Constipation symptoms vary by individual, but taking it before bedtime will show effects the next morning (typically 6 to 11 hours later).
(2) Once bowel movements improve after taking it, gradually extend the time between doses to restore normal bowel habits.

Dosage and Administration-Usually, adults should take two tablets once daily before bedtime or several hours before expected bowel movement. Swallow whole with water or lukewarm water. -Precautions Regarding Dosage and Administration- (1) Strictly adhere to the prescribed dosage and administration. (2) Take preferably on an empty stomach. (3) Avoid taking within one hour of consuming antacids* or milk.(This medicine may dissolve in the stomach due to antacids or milk, preventing it from achieving the desired effect.) *Antacids: Ingredients found in many stomach medicines that neutralize stomach acid. (4) Do not chew or crush the tablets; swallow them whole. (This medicine has a special coating to ensure the active ingredient fully releases its effectiveness and acts within the large intestine.)
Each 2 tablets contain Bisacodyl...10mg (Directly stimulates the large intestine to enhance weakened intestinal peristalsis.) Excipients: Sucrose, Talc, Gum Arabic, Castor Oil,Methacrylic acid copolymer S, Methacrylic acid copolymer L, Corn starch, Magnesium stearate, Glycerin, Titanium dioxide, Lactose, Red No. 3, Carnauba wax, Beeswax, Macrogol
1. Do not take the following medicines while taking this product: Other laxatives 2. Do not take large amounts.
